https://blog.csdn.net/olsQ93038o99S/article/details/117393089
背景 最近在做iOS的DNS解析,順便研究了下iOS端本地的DNS解析方式(localDNS),也就是不依賴Http請求,而是用原始的API進行解析,雖然有HttpDNS但是...
一 .什么時候需要考慮粘包問題? 如果利用tcp每次發(fā)送數(shù)據(jù),就與對方建立連接,然后雙方發(fā)送完一段數(shù)據(jù)后,就關(guān)閉連接,這樣就不會出現(xiàn)粘包問題(因為只有一種包結(jié)構(gòu),類似于htt...
這個欄目將持續(xù)更新--請iOS的小伙伴關(guān)注! (答案不唯一,僅供參考,文章最后有福利) iOS面試題大全(上)[http://www.itdecent.cn/c/31a51...
Autorelease對象什么時候釋放? 這個問題拿來做面試題,問過很多人,沒有幾個能答對的。很多答案都是“當前作用域大括號結(jié)束時釋放”,顯然木有正確理解Autoreleas...
親測可用 一、原理Beyond Compare每次啟動后會先檢查注冊信息,試用期到期后就不能繼續(xù)使用。解決方法是在啟動前,先刪除注冊信息,然后再啟動,這樣就可以永久免費試用了...
題目出處:作者:Cooci鏈接:https://juejin.cn/post/6983175020340051976[https://juejin.cn/post/69831...
前言 大概捋了一下iOS面試知識點,以此作為大綱希望自己能有目標有計劃地準備面試,后面我會逐個復習一下相應的內(nèi)容,同時也會添加遺漏的知識點到文本,并記錄下自己的筆記分享出來。...
請先安裝CocoaPods,步驟可以自行百度,這里略過. 如果lint失敗請升級CocoaPods 為什么要搞私有pod:1. 組件化(此路漫漫),通過pod的方式將項目組件...
Giteehttps://gitee.com/LiynXu/xcode-device-support[https://gitee.com/LiynXu/xcode-devic...
大佬有無15.3?
iOS--DeviceSupport (已更新至15.2 (21C51))Giteehttps://gitee.com/LiynXu/xcode-device-support[https://gitee.com/LiynXu/xcode-devic...
目錄 APNs 簡介 Apple Push Notification service (APNs),即蘋果推送通知服務。 為什么會有 APNs ? 由于移動設(shè)備內(nèi)存、CPU、...
這不是才三種情況,還有一種呢?
iOS 引起循環(huán)引用的四種情況造成循環(huán)引用的原因,就是兩個及兩個以上的對象相互強引用,無法釋放。 一、block一般情況下,我們使用copy修飾block,但copy的作用只是將block從棧區(qū)拷貝到堆區(qū)...
+load 方法 1. 如果一個類實現(xiàn)了load 方法,那么在類被加載到內(nèi)存的時候就會調(diào)用,與這個類是否被用到無關(guān)。執(zhí)行在main函數(shù)之前,此時運行環(huán)境不安全,不能在這份方法...
介紹 動態(tài)庫形式:.dylib和.framework 靜態(tài)庫形式:.a和.framework 動態(tài)庫和靜態(tài)庫的區(qū)別 靜態(tài)庫:鏈接時,靜態(tài)庫會被完整地復制到可執(zhí)行文件中,被多次...